Navigating conflicting opinions within a team is a common challenge in project management. When priorities are not aligned, it can lead to tension and inefficiency. However, as a leader, you possess the tools to steer these discussions towards a productive resolution. Your role is to facilitate a dialogue that acknowledges each team member's perspective while guiding them towards a consensus that aligns with the project's goals. Performance management skills play a crucial role in this process, ensuring that the team remains focused on outcomes without disregarding individual contributions and insights.
